    DPW must perform engineering studies in accordance with the Federal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D) before installing an all-way stop. The MUTCD conditions are mainly about a combination of traffic on the free flow street and the stopped street. The intersection of Leigh St and 30th St does not meet the traffic requirements of the MUTCD for all-way stops. The DMV crash database for the latest five full years (1.1.20– 12.31.24) also showed only one reported crash.
